According to ESPN, Sergio Ramos is at an advanced stage of negotiations with Paris Saint-Germain following his departure from Real Madrid. All in all, it’s only a matter of days before Ramos join forces with the Qatar-owned French club.

The Ligue 1 giants have taken huge strides this summer in an attempt to build a winning project. They started off with Neymar Jr’s contract renewal, followed by the signing of Georgino Wijnaldum and are now closing deals with Achraf Hakimi, Gianluigi Donnarruma, and Sergio Ramos.

According to RMC Sport, it is true that Mbappe wants a move to Real Madrid, however, emotions have been set aside by the 22-year-old who wants a winning project more than anything else. In the past few days, social media outlets have exploded with Mbappe posts regarding his decision of not wanting to renew his contract. However, his tune could change if Paris Saint-Germain offer a more impressive sporting project, one that can lead to Champions League glory.

What impact does Sergio Ramos’ signing have on Mbappe’s future at PSG?

Well, just the signing of Sergio Ramos itself will not change everything, however, his signing would certainly be a testament to Mbappe that Paris Saint-Germain are working hard in building the best possible squad.

They’ve gone far in the Champions League in recent years but have fallen short in the decisive moments, maybe it’s the experience factor that PSG are lacking. With Ramos in the heart of the defence, the French giants have a voice, a leader, and a man with the experience of winning Europe’s elite competition on four occasions.

With that being said, Mbappe will have to sit back over the long summer and make a decision on his future. Paris Saint-Germain at the moment seem to be the better side and are working in tandem towards winning the Champions League.
